Refried Bean Bowl
Creamy mashed beans over rice with fresh, colourful toppings.
Origin & Story
Frijoles refritos ('well-fried beans') are a cornerstone of Mexican cuisine. Beans are simmered, then mashed and fried for a rich, creamy base that stretches a tiny budget a long way.
Main Spices & Their Role
Cumin
The defining warm, earthy note of the beans.
Chilli powder
Adds gentle heat and colour.
Ingredients
- 1 can beans
- 1 cup cooked rice
- 1/2 tsp cumin
- 1/4 tsp chilli powder
- 1/2 onion
- 2 tbsp oil
- Tomato, coriander & lime to top
Method
- 01
Saute onion in oil, then add the spices.
- 02
Add beans with their liquid and mash to a rough paste.
- 03
Cook until thick and creamy, seasoning with salt.
- 04
Spoon over a bowl of warm rice.
- 05
Top with tomato, coriander and a squeeze of lime.
Veg & Vegan Alternatives
Vegetarian
This dish is already vegetarian.
Vegan
Already vegan — traditionally lard is used, so cook the beans in oil (as here) to keep them plant-based.
